This device works based on Hooke’s Law that states that the necessary force that extends a spring is directly proportional to the distance the spring is extended from its rest position. In a spring scale, the spring either stretches (as in a hanging scale in the produce department of a grocery store) or compresses (as in a simple bathroom scale). When a load is hung on the spring, it stretches and the spring's extension is proportional to the weight of the object. Small scales with sensitive springs can be used to measure differences of up to a gram or less, though these will break if heavy weights were attached to them.
